WHAT YOU WILL DO:As a Senior Manager, R&D Engineering, you will provide leadership and direction to the New Product Engineering team while ensuring compliance to global medical device regulations. With your team, you will identify, develop, and scale-up strategy for laser technologies. You will be responsible for building, developing, and managing the performance of engineers. Responsibilities of the role include:
    • Identify new strategies and projects for the investigation, design, and implementation of new or improved products and/or applications for laser cutting technologies.
    • Through self and staff, identify future technology and intellectual property critical to future business growth and drives implementation.
    • Drive technical projects and programs of major magnitude and scope. Follow, and provide leadership in developing, design control and quality system requirements (specifically for laser technologies).
    • Establish internal contacts across Stryker and external contacts for industry laser cutting technology specialists. For self and staff, ensure sharing of initiatives/ideas and accomplishments across the divisions.
    • Provide significant guidance and approval regarding technical strategies and approaches.
    • Provide guidance and training to staff, assist subordinates in attaining career goals, motivate individuals to achieve results, and recruit & maintain a high quality staff.
    • Drive the development of department tools and methodologies for sustaining laser technologies.
    • Work cross-functionally in identifying and resolving technical issues.
    • Establish and support a work environment of continuous improvement that supports Quality Policy, Quality System and the appropriate regulations for the area they support. -
    • Lead strategy development for Process and Product Development and participatory role for Global Quality & Operations (GQO) partner(s). Communication channel to/from GQO in working through laser scale-up strategy.
    • Manage execution of the Process & Technology Development functional deliverables associated with the Technology Development Projects, Product Development Projects, Project Management, and Quality Systems.WHAT YOU NEED:Required:
      • B.S. degree in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Biomedical Engineering, or applicable technical field.
      • 10+ years of experience in device/process design & development (including laser technology applications experience).Preferred:
        • M.S. or/and Ph.D. in Engineering or related field.
        • 5+ years of laser applications experience.
        • 5+ years of people management experience.
        • Medical device or regulated industry experience.Travel Percentage: 30%Stryker Corporation is an equal opportunity employer.
